INTERMITTENT PROBLEM STARTING

hi guys.

I'm a newcomer here, so sorry if this is a silly question.

my wife's car is difficult to start, feels like a fuel problem. dirty filter or pump. is it possible to do a DIY job on this problem

Yes. The fuel sender assembly (pump, filter, gauge sender) is located within the tank. There is an access panel on the floor below the rear seats of the car.
